Mr. Lloyd "Pug" Thompson's Obituary
Lloyd "Pug" Thompson, age 88, of Algonac, died March 10, 2015 at Medilodge of St. Clair, where he was a resident for four years. He was born March 22, 1926 in Algonac to the late Lloyd E. and Lillian Thompson. On October 9, 1947 Lloyd married Marilyn Meldrum. He was a proud veteran of World War II, serving honorably with the U.S. Army from 1944 to 1946. Pug worked for the Algonac Community Schools for 23 years and was a parishioner of St. Catherine Church for 67 years.
He is survived by his wife of 67 years, Marilyn Thompson, children; Gary (Sharon) Thompson, Dale Thompson, Mary (Paul) McGeachy, Glen Thompson, Jeff (Gina) Thompson and Lisa (Richard) Sampson, 10 grandchildren and 3 great grandchildren. He was preceded in death by his son, Paul Thompson and a sister, Betty Campbell.
